1. Rapid advancements: The fast pace of nanotechnology innovation often outstrips the ability of regulations to keep up.
2. Interdisciplinary nature: Nanotechnology spans multiple fields, requiring collaborative regulatory approaches.
3.
Data availability: Limited data on the long-term effects of nanomaterials complicates risk assessment.
4. Global harmonization: Differences in regulations across countries can create barriers to international trade and collaboration.
